This proposed AD was prompted by reports of dual pitch rate sensor (PRS) failures, resulting in autopilot disconnects. This proposed AD would require an inspection to determine the PRS part number and replacement if necessary. We are proposing this AD to prevent a dual PRS failure that could cause an automatic disengagement of the autopilot and autoland, which may prevent continued safe flight and landing if disengagement occurs at low altitude and the flight crew is unable to safely assume control and execute a go-around or manual landing.", "2014-04-25", 2014, 4, "https://www.federalregister.gov/documents/2014/04/25/2014-09409/airworthiness-directives-the-boeing-company-airplanes", "https://www.govinfo.gov/content/pkg/FR-2014-04-25/pdf/2014-09409.pdf", "Transportation Department; Federal Aviation Administration", "492,159", "We propose to adopt a new airworthiness directive (AD) for certain The Boeing Company Model 777 airplanes.
